1. NVIDIA RTX 4000 Ada – The Perfect Balance for Designers & Mid-Level Creators

Who Is It For?

  • Architects using Revit, ArchiCAD, Rhino, 3ds Max

  • Designers using AutoCAD, SolidWorks (mid-level), SketchUp, Blender

  • Video editors using Premiere Pro, DaVinci Resolve

  • Motion graphics professionals using After Effects

Detailed Performance Insights

  • 20GB ECC memory allows manipulation of medium-to-large 3D models without bottlenecks.

  • AI-powered denoising dramatically accelerates viewport renders in Blender & 3ds Max.

  • Ray tracing performance is approx 2.5× faster than previous gen (Ampere equivalent).

  • Easily handles 4K timelines and multi-layer compositions.

Where It Fits in the Workflow

  • Architectural walkthroughs

  • Product visualization

  • Medium-scale simulations

  • Creative production for agencies & studios


2. NVIDIA RTX 4500 Ada – The Engineering & Simulation Powerhouse

Who Is It For?

  • Mechanical engineers working with Creo, CATIA, SolidWorks, Siemens NX

  • Simulation engineers using Ansys Mechanical, Fluent, Abaqus

  • Teams working with large assemblies in manufacturing design

In-Depth Capabilities

  • 24GB ECC memory is ideal for complex assemblies, FEA, CFD models.

  • Significantly faster double-precision performance for scientific workloads.

  • Supports real-time simulation preview with GPU acceleration.

  • Delivers 35–45% higher compute performance over RTX 4000 Ada.

Best Use-Cases

  • Automotive component design

  • Aerospace structural analysis

  • Manufacturing workflow optimization

  • High-resolution meshing & simulation pre-processing


3. NVIDIA RTX 5000 Ada – VFX, Animation & Rendering Studio Favourite

Who Is It For?

  • VFX studios using Houdini, Maya, Nuke, Blender, Unreal Engine

  • Animation houses rendering large scenes

  • XR, Virtual Production, Motion Capture pipelines

  • GPU render farms (Octane, Redshift, V-Ray GPU)

Deep Technical Advantages

  • 32GB ECC memory enables handling huge scenes with thousands of assets.

  • Real-time ray tracing delivers cinematic-level lighting in Unreal Engine.

  • Supports massive GPU-resident geometry caches, reducing I/O delays.

  • Perfect for multi-GPU setups to scale render pipelines.

What This GPU Unlocks

  • Real-time preview of VFX shots

  • Faster bake times for simulations (smoke, fire, particles)

  • High-poly sculpting without lag

  • End-to-end rendering workflow acceleration


4. NVIDIA RTX 6000 Ada – The Unmatched GPU for AI, Research & Enterprise

Who Is It For?

  • AI/ML engineers building LLMs, CNNs, GANs

  • Data scientists using PyTorch, TensorFlow, RAPIDS

  • Scientific research labs (biology, physics, visualization)

  • Enterprise-grade simulation clusters

  • High-end VFX rendering farms

What Makes It the Ultimate GPU

  • 48GB ECC GDDR6 — large enough for multi-billion parameter AI models.

  • Unparalleled Tensor Core performance offering up to 5× training speed-ups.

  • Extremely high memory bandwidth for large datasets.

  • Handles complex scientific visualizations (3D MRI, fluid dynamics, GIS datasets).

Enterprise-Level Use Cases

  • AI inference servers

  • Large dataset training

  • GPU clusters for research

  • Scientific visualization at scale

  • Enterprise render farms

Real-World Workflow Advantages of RTX Ada GPUs

 

NVIDIA RTX Ada Generation workstation GPU lineup for professional creators, engineers, and AI developers – Supreme Computers Chennai

 

🔹 Faster AI & ML Model Training

With 4th-gen Tensor cores, Ada GPUs deliver:

  • Faster training speeds

  • Lower inference latency

  • Optimized performance for LLMs and generative AI

🔹 Engineering Simulations Run 2× Faster

Highly parallel workloads like:

  • Linear static simulations

  • Thermal analysis

  • Computational fluid dynamics

  • Nonlinear structural analysis

benefit significantly from Ada's improved architecture.

🔹 VFX / 3D Rendering Productivity Jump

Ada GPUs cut render times dramatically thanks to:

  • Next-gen ray tracing

  • AI denoising

  • Increased VRAM for complex assets

🔹 Architecture & BIM Workflows Become Smoother

Large models in Revit, Navisworks or Rhino load faster and navigate smoother.

🔹 Reliability for Mission-Critical Work

ECC memory + ISV certifications guarantee stability in enterprise environments.
